The cable equalizer supports operation at 270 Mbit SD, 1.5 Gbit HD, and 2.97 Gbit
dual-link HD modes. Control signals are allowed for bypassing or disabling the
device, as well as a carrier detect or auto-mute signal interface.

Table 2–27

lists the cable equalizer lengths.

Figure 2–9

shows the SDI cable equalizer, which is an excerpt from the LMH0384

cable equalizer data sheet. On this development board, the output is a single-ended
output, with the negative channel driving a load local to the board.
